Based in the Eden Valley, our mountaineering club, founded in 1974, has a history of trad climbing, sport climbing, fell walking, cycling, ski-touring and much, much more. We are the club for all outdoor activity enthusiasts.
Eden Valley Mountaineering Club (EVMC) is based in Penrith and the Eden Valley. The club is active all year and puts you in touch with a wide range of like-minded individuals.

Members are active in a wide range of fell and mountain-based pursuits, from ice climbing to sport climbing, fell walking, running, cycling, ski-touring and much, much more. We organise a comprehensive range of activities which include: a weekly Wednesday evening climbing meet; monthly climbing meets; monthly scrambling / walking meets; weekends away to UK destinations; overseas trips; ad hoc meets; social events.
In the winter we are often found at the Eden Climbing Wall dreaming of the sun. Club members are out on the local crags every Wednesday evening in the summer.
